What is SIMAssist?
SIMAssist is an Airports Council International (ACI) Africa programme that supports airports in strengthening emergency preparedness through ICAO-compliant simulation exercises.
It provides practical, expert-led support to design, deliver and evaluate Tabletop (TTX) and Full-Scale Simulation Exercises (FSX), aligned with ICAO Annex 14 and aerodrome certification requirements.

How the programme works
SIMAssist follows a three-phase methodology:
1. Planning & Design
Needs assessment, AEP review, scenario development
2. Exercise Delivery
Tabletop Exercise (TTX) followed by live Full-Scale Simulation (FSX)
3. Evaluation & Improvement
After-action review and corrective action planning
Timelines are adapted to airport size, complexity and regulatory context.
